Output 44f260af87b539935c389fe2864dfb74212087c24429d6b32cae7ec08d7942c5:12

value
6500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93eacbb3318e62e3148b07cb0e66647ccb155509 OP_EQUAL
address
3FB8Xdjx36bugH1iv94cVTcQdyT6L2W92s
transaction
44f260af87b539935c389fe2864dfb74212087c24429d6b32cae7ec08d7942c5
spent
true